Which Countertop Material Is Right for You? Exploring Three Popular Options

Choosing the right kitchen countertop can significantly influence the functionality, aesthetics, and overall value of your kitchen. With numerous materials available on the market, selecting the perfect countertop can be challenging. To assist in navigating this crucial choice, let's explore the top three types of kitchen countertops that homeowners and designers prefer for their durability, appearance, and ease of maintenance.

granite countertops

First on the list is granite, a natural stone that has long been favored for its unique patterns, robustness, and resistance to heat and scratches. Each slab of granite is one-of-a-kind, offering a variety of colors and natural designs that can complement any kitchen style, from traditional to modern. Although granite countertops require periodic sealing to maintain their resistance to stains, their beauty and longevity make them a worthwhile investment for many homeowners.

quartz countertops

Next, we have quartz, an engineered stone that has gained popularity for its versatility and low maintenance. Unlike natural stone, quartz countertops are non-porous, making them highly resistant to staining and eliminating the need for regular sealing. They come in a wide range of colors and patterns, including options that mimic the look of granite, marble, and other natural stones. With its durability and ease of care, quartz is an excellent choice for busy kitchens.

butcher block countertops

Lastly, butcher block countertops add warmth and natural beauty to the kitchen with their wood construction. Typically made from pieces of wood cut straight from the tree and glued together to form a solid surface, these countertops offer a classic and inviting look. Butcher block is ideal for those who love to cook, as it provides a sturdy and functional work surface. It does require regular oiling to protect the wood and prevent drying or cracking, but with proper care, butcher block countertops can last for many years and age gracefully.


Whether you lean towards the natural elegance of granite, the practicality and range of quartz, or the rustic charm of butcher block, there's a countertop material out there that will meet your kitchen's needs and reflect your personal style. Consider your lifestyle, budget, and design preferences when choosing your countertop to ensure that your kitchen not only looks fantastic, but also works efficiently for your daily life.
